Transaction 870985f29350e1eb145214fbdc11bc4ecea131ebd0c187ffdfbadb3e8aeecb6d

32 Input
2 Outputs
  • 870985f29350e1eb145214fbdc11bc4ecea131ebd0c187ffdfbadb3e8aeecb6d:0
  • value  515529095
    address  1LpSavvMfus68guCEVNp6r25fs9WCQVJj9
  • 870985f29350e1eb145214fbdc11bc4ecea131ebd0c187ffdfbadb3e8aeecb6d:1
  • value  1000043
    address  1Js2ny9kPDGyemBCwjVEvK2fc7XTjYPEkp